Day 79, Yahweh… The Role of a Servant
1Kings 18:36-39 (Holman Christian Standard Bible)
"Lord God of Abraham, Isaac, and Israel, today let it be known that You are God in Israel and I am Your servant, and that at Your word I have done all these things. Answer me, Lord! Answer me so that this people will know that You, Yahweh, are God and that You have turned their hearts back."
Then Yahweh's fire fell and consumed the burnt offering, the wood, the stones, and the dust, and it licked up the water that was in the trench. When all the people saw it, they fell facedown and said, "Yahweh, He is God! Yahweh, He is God!"
We tend to look down on the idea of being a … servant.  For us the idea is demeaning ... the idea of being a servant ... but not really so demeaning in Israel.  In the Hebrew mind it was an honor to serve in the King's court ... it was an honor to serve the King.
For Elijah to refer to himself as the servant of Yahweh ... what an honor and what a place of humble recognition .... a dream that was really unthinkable to mortal man.
Could we raise our heads to grasp the honor of the title …Servant of Yahweh ... then could we for just a moment consider actually embracing the idea?
